// Build agents in the Corvella fleet drift apart under load; NTP sync
// only runs hourly on the older Brickhaven images. Artifact timestamps
// can therefore disagree by several seconds, which breaks staleness
// checks in the pipeline. We tolerate a bounded skew rather than
// failing builds outright. The tolerance windows are defined below.

constants for tageg-kagag:
QUOTAS = {
    "kelax": 495,
    "istath": 366,
    "tammir": 108,
    "novdor": 730,
    "casax": 816,
    "quenael": 874,
    "pelius": 403,
}

Ticket: Locked vault blocking static-analysis baseline update

For the release manager: the Pinemark release pipeline failed because the vault holding the signed static-analysis baseline file is locked. Without the baseline, Scanforge treats every finding as new and blocks the cut. The lock triggered after the rotation job crashed mid-cycle last night. To proceed, open the vault recovery prompt from the release runner, confirm the build tag matches the candidate, and supply the recovery passphrase that appears just below this line.

vault phrase of hawif-bahof = novvan-belius-istael-fenvan-holdor-druox-eliath

Ticket: Expired credentials — Emberline firmware channel

The push credentials for the Emberline device-firmware update channel expired last night. Staged firmware builds are blocked from publishing. A replacement key has been issued for the internal channel service and needs security sign-off before deployment. Please review scope and expiry, then confirm. The newly issued key follows below.

service key, kaduf-bawig: kto15_Ze79S0dligTw0yO